Main duties of the job
If you area self-motivated and forward-thinking individual and would like to play an integral part in pharmacy service developments we have the perfect opportunity for you. We are looking for a dynamic and highly motivated individual to be responsible for the coordination and production of the Intravenous Chemotherapy Clinics. You will be able to demonstrate strong leadership skills managing staff, problem solving skills to resolve stock ordering issues and communication skills to liaise with the day units and wards regarding patients and their treatment. You will be integral to supply and preparation of other bespoke aseptic medicinal products, such as biologics and parenteral nutrition, to the trust. Due to recent exciting developments, the post holder will contribute to the Trusts expanding portfolio of clinical trials and will play an active role in the preparation, supply, and governance of investigational medicinal products (IMPs), ensuring compliance with Good Clinical Practice (GCP) and regulatory frameworks.
You will be responsible for the coordination and production of the Intravenous Chemotherapy Clinics (including those provided for Weston Park Hospital outreach clinics). Which includes things such as liaising with the Chemotherapy team to ensure that the clinics run efficiently and safely and in a timely manner, co-ordinate and participate in the production and preparation of the IV Chemotherapy and resolve stock discrepancies and action drug alerts.
